1.23 GB Page-outsFirst, back up all data immediately unless you already have a current backup. If you can't back up, stop here. Do not take any of the steps below.
Step 1
This diagnostic procedure will query the log for messages that may indicate a system issue. It changes nothing, and therefore will not, in itself, solve your problem.
If you have more than one user account, these instructions must be carried out as an administrator.
Triple-click anywhere in the line below on this page to select it:
syslog -k Sender kernel -k Message CReq 'GPU |hfs: Ru|I/O e|find tok|n Cause: -|NVDA\(|pagin|timed? ?o' | tail | open -ef
Copy the selected text to the Clipboard by pressing the key combination command-C.
Launch the Terminal application in any of the following ways:
☞ Enter the first few letters of its name into a Spotlight search. Select it in the results (it should be at the top.)
☞ In the Finder, select Go ▹ Utilities from the menu bar, or press the key combination shift-command-U. The application is in the folder that opens.
☞ Open LaunchPad. Click Utilities, then Terminal in the icon grid.
Paste into the Terminal window (command-V). I've tested these instructions only with the Safari web browser. If you use another browser, you may have to press the return key.
The command may take a noticeable amount of time to run. Wait for a new line ending in a dollar sign (“$”) to appear.
A TextEdit window will open with the output of the command. Normally the command will produce no output, and the window will be empty. If the TextEdit window (not the Terminal window) has anything in it, stop here and post it — the text, please, not a screenshot. The title of the TextEdit window doesn't matter, and you don't need to post that.
Step 2
There are a few other possible causes of generalized slow performance that you can rule out easily.
Disconnect all non-essential wired peripherals and remove aftermarket expansion cards, if any.
Reset the System Management Controller.
Run Software Update. If there's a firmware update, install it.
If you're booting from an aftermarket SSD, see whether there's a firmware update for it.
If you have a portable computer, check the cycle count of the battery. It may be due for replacement.
If you have many image or video files on the Desktop with preview icons, move them to another folder.
If applicable, uncheck all boxes in the iCloud preference pane. See whether there's any change.
Check your keychains in Keychain Access for excessively duplicated items.
Boot into Recovery mode, launch Disk Utility, and run Repair Disk.
If you have a MacBook Pro with dual graphics, disable automatic graphics switching in the Energy Saverpreference pane for better performance at the cost of shorter battery life.
Step 3
When you notice the problem, launch the Activity Monitor application in any of the following ways:
☞ Enter the first few letters of its name into a Spotlight search. Select it in the results (it should be at the top.)
☞ In the Finder, select Go ▹ Utilities from the menu bar, or press the key combination shift-command-U. The application is in the folder that opens.
☞ Open LaunchPad. Click Utilities, then Activity Monitor in the icon grid.
Select the CPU tab of the Activity Monitor window.
Select All Processes from the View menu or the menu in the toolbar, if not already selected.
Click the heading of the % CPU column in the process table to sort the entries by CPU usage. You may have to click it twice to get the highest value at the top. What is it, and what is the process? Also post the values for User, System, and Idle at the bottom of the window.
Select the Memory tab. What value is shown in the bottom part of the window for Swap used?
Next, select the Disk tab. Post the approximate values shown for Reads in/sec and Writes out/sec (not Reads in andWrites out.)
Step 4
If you have more than one user account, you must be logged in as an administrator to carry out this step.
Launch the Console application in the same way you launched Activity Monitor. Make sure the title of the Console window is All Messages. If it isn't, select All Messages from the SYSTEM LOG QUERIES menu on the left. If you don't see that menu, select
View ▹ Show Log List
from the menu bar.
Select the 50 or so most recent entries in the log. Copy them to the Clipboard by pressing the key combinationcommand-C. Paste into a reply to this message (command-V). You're looking for entries at the end of the log, not at the beginning.
When posting a log extract, be selective. Don't post more than is requested.
Please do not indiscriminately dump thousands of lines from the log into this discussion.
Important: Some personal information, such as your name, may appear in the log. Anonymize before posting. That should be easy to do if your extract is not too long. -

Slow as a snail Time Capsule - suggestions please?
I have been using a 1Tb Time Capsule for backing up about 600 Gb of mainly image information along with my main HD for a year or so without any major problems. The drive was full a long time ago but (as I understood it) when new material comes along the oldest backup info is deleted automatically. Yesterday for some reason (after a major Lightroom reshuffle) the backup routine stopped with a message saying "Your backup requires 300 Gb of space but you only have 250 GB (or along those lines).
In the end I erased all on the TC and started again. No problem except the transfer speed has slowed to a snail's pace. Calculating the speed at the moment it will take over 24 hours to backup 490 Gb. Is this correct? The TC is connected by regular ethernet cable, I have a MacPro 2 x 2.66 with 8Gb RAM and 3 internal hard drives. How can I speed up this process? Would I be better off with regular external hard drives connected by firewire?
How come I can download a Compact Flash card of 8 Gb in about 5 minutes and it takes half an hour or so fo the equivalent amount of data to backup on the TC? Thank you.Colin Cadle wrote:
In the end I erased all on the TC and started again. No problem except the transfer speed has slowed to a snail's pace. Calculating the speed at the moment it will take over 24 hours to backup 490 Gb. Is this correct? The TC is connected by regular ethernet cable
Roughly, yes. It varies greatly, of course, and the first part of a full backup is considerably slower (since the Applications and System folders are the first to be backed-up, and contain hundreds of thousands of mostly very small files). But overall you should get, very roughly, 20-24 GB/hour via Ethernet.
There are a couple of things you can do that might speed it up. See #D2 in [Time Machine - Troubleshooting|http://web.me.com/pondini/Time_Machine/Troubleshooting.html] (or use the link in *User Tips* at the top of the +Time Machine+ forum).
Would I be better off with regular external hard drives connected by firewire?
Oh, yes! With F/W 400 expect roughly 50-55 GB/hour overall; F/W 800 80-85 GB/hour. For a laptop, the convenience of wireless backups is great, but for a desktop, it's a real drag, pardon the pun.
How come I can download a Compact Flash card of 8 Gb in about 5 minutes and it takes half an hour or so fo the equivalent amount of data to backup on the TC? Thank you.
There's a lot more to be done with a Time Machine backup than just copying files. They have a very complex structure, with things extensively linked together so Time Machine can do it's "magic" of only backing-up what's changed, but having each backup be a full one. -

Why is Thunderbolt so much slower than USB3?
I'm considering two different drives for Time Machine purposes. Both are LaCie. Either of these:
- Two Porsche 9233 drives, 4 TB each
OR
- A 2Big Thunderbolt drive, 8 TB, which I would configure as RAID 1 (a mirrored 4 TB volume)
My question is this: I've viewed both of these product pages via the Apple Store, and I noticed that LaCie's information for the Thunderbolt drive makes it a lot slower than the USB drives. Meaning: They say that the 2Big Thunderbolt drive maxes out at like 427 MB/s, whereas the Porsche USB drives max out at 5 GB/s. Why is this? Isn't Thunderbolt supposed to be a lot faster than USB (any iteration)?Not an easy question, short of a whole lot more detail on the construction of those two devices. You're likely going to need to look at the details of the drives and probably at some actual data. You're really looking for some real benchmark data that you can compare, in other words. Particularly which (likely Seagate) drives are used in those (IIRC, Seagate bought LaCie a while back), and what the specs are.
The hard disk drives themselves are a central factor, where the drive transfer rate is a key metric for big transfers (and that can be based on drive RPM as much as anything, faster drives can stream more data, but they tend to need more power and run hotter), and access (seek) time for lots of smaller transfers (faster seeks mean faster access, so good for lots of small files scattered around). Finding the details of the drives can be interesting, though. I've seen lots of cheaper disks that spin very slowly, which means that they can have nice-looking transfer times out of any cache, but then... you... wait... for... the... disk... to... spin.
The device bus interfaces can also vary (wildly) in quality. I've seen some decent ones, and I've seen some USB adapters that were absolute garbage. Some devices have decent quantities of cache, too. Others have dinky caches, and end up doing synchronous transfers to hard disks, and that's glacial compared with memory speeds.
One of your example configurations also features RAID 1 mirroring, which means that each write is hitting both disks. The writes have to pass through a controller that can do RAID 0 mirroring, and that can write the I/O requests to both drives, and that can read the data back from (if it's clever) whichever of the two drives is best positioned in related to the sectors you're after. If it's dumb, it won't account for the head positions and drive rotation and sector target. Hopefully the controller is smart enough to correctly deal with a disk failure; I've met a few RAID controllers that weren't as effective when disks had failed and the array was running in a degrated mode. In short, RAID 1 mirroring is a reliability-targeted configuration and not a performance configuration. It'll be slower. Lose a disk in RAID 1 mirroring, and you have a second disk with a second copy. If the controller works right.
If you want I/O performance without reliability, then configure for RAID 0 striping. With that configuration, you're reading data from both disks. But lose a disk in a RAID 0 striping configuration and you're dealing with data recovery, at best. If the failure is catastrophic, you've lost half your data.
But nobody's going to make this choice for you, and I'd be skeptical of any specs outside of actual benchmarks, and preferably benchmarks approximating your use. Reliability is another factor, and that's largely down to reputation in the market; how well the vendor supports the devices, should something go wrong. One of the few ways to sort-of compare that beyond the reviews is the relative length of the warranty, and what the warranty covers; vendors generally try to design and build their devices to last at least the length of the warranty.
Yeah. Lots of factors to consider. No good answers, either. Given it's a backup disk, I'd personally tend to favor eliability and warranty and less about brute speed.

I am using Google Chrome on both Windows 7 and Mac OSX but, I have also tried Firefox and Safari.Please read this whole message before doing anything.
This procedure is a diagnostic test. It’s unlikely to solve your problem. Don’t be disappointed when you find that nothing has changed after you complete it.
The purpose of the test is to determine whether the problem is caused by third-party software that loads automatically at startup or login, or by a peripheral device.
Disconnect all wired peripherals except those needed for the test, and remove all aftermarket expansion cards. Boot in safe mode and log in to the account with the problem. Note: If FileVault is enabled, or if a firmware password is set, or if the boot volume is a software RAID, you can’t do this. Post for further instructions.
Safe mode is much slower to boot and run than normal, and some things won’t work at all, including wireless networking on certain Macs. The next normal boot may also be somewhat slow.
The login screen appears even if you usually log in automatically. You must know your login password in order to log in. If you’ve forgotten the password, you will need to reset it before you begin. Test while in safe mode. Same problem? After testing, reboot as usual (i.e., not in safe mode) and verify that you still have the problem. Post the results of the test. -
